Adoption Timeline

  • Application sent to Holt - August 14, 2004

  • Homestudy done - December 30, 2004

  • I171H received - February 8, 2005 (Chinese New Year's Eve - Happy Year of the Rooster)

  • Dossier sent to China - February 18, 2005

  • Log in Date at the CCAA - March 7, 2005

  • We ask Holt to tell us the name of waiting child G05_59 (Li Juan!) - June 28, 2005

  • We receive Li Juan's packet of information from Holt - July 19, 2005

  • We send our completed Waiting Child forms to Holt - July 26, 2005

  • Li Juan's 2nd birthday party at our house in Marina, CA - August 17, 2005

  • Holt Committee Meeting and Referral Day - We were chosen to be Li Juan's Forever Family - September 1, 2005

  • Letter of Intent sent to China - September 16, 2005

  • Travel Approval - October 27, 2005

  • Travel to Beijing - November 16/17, 2005

  • Travel to Changchun, Jilin and GOTCHA DAY!!! - November 22, 2005

  • Travel to Guangzhou - November 28, 2005

  • Consulate Appointment - November 30, 2005

  • Travel home with our daughter, Clara Li Juan - December 2, 2005
